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Mount Sebert.
- Start your hike early in the morning to avoid the heat and enjoy cooler temperatures.
- Bring plenty of water and snacks to stay hydrated and energized during your hike.
- Wear sturdy hiking shoes to navigate the trails safely.
- Consider bringing a camera to capture the stunning panoramic views from the peak.
- Check the weather forecast before your visit for the best hiking conditions.

Getting There
-
Car
From any location on St. Anne Island, head towards the main road that circles the island. Drive or follow the road southeast until you reach the junction with the road leading towards Mount Sebert. The drive is relatively short, typically taking about 10-15 minutes depending on traffic. Look for signs indicating the way to Mount Sebert. Once you reach the designated area, you may need to park your vehicle at a nearby parking area, as direct access to the peak may require a short hike.
-
Public Transportation
If you are using public transportation, look for local buses or shuttle services that operate on St. Anne Island. Inform the driver you want to go to Mount Sebert; they will drop you off at the nearest stop. From there, you may have to walk a short distance, approximately 10-20 minutes, along local paths to reach the base of Mount Sebert. Ensure to check the bus schedule ahead of time, as services may vary.
-
Walking
If you're already close to Mount Sebert, you can hike to the peak on foot. From your location, navigate towards the main paths leading up the mountain. The terrain can be uneven, so make sure to wear appropriate footwear. The hike may take around 30-60 minutes depending on your fitness level. Enjoy the lush surroundings and keep an eye out for local wildlife along the trail.
